[Octopus-users] problem with octopus 3.1.0 tests in an itanium architecture
Miguel Pan Fidalgo
mpan at cesga.es
Thu Aug 6 08:20:49 WEST 2009
hi everybody,
I am Miguel Pan, Applications technician at CESGA (The Supercomputing Center of Galicia). A center for high-performance computing.
I had installed Octopus 3.0.1 (serial and mpi version) properly using intel compilers and the module tool to load dynamically the libraries that I needed in FinisTerrae (Itanium) [http://www.cesga.es/content/view/917/115/lang,en/ ]. This was the script for the serial version (for example):
$ cat script_de_configuration.sh
#!/bin/bash
module load gsl/1.12 icc/11.0.074 ifort/11.0.074 fftw/3.1.2 mkl/10.1.0 impi/3.2.0.011 netcdf/4.0 SPARSKIT/2
export CC="icc"
export CFLAGS="-O3 -ip -ftz"
export LDFLAGS="-lguide -lpthread -lm"
export F77="ifort"
export FFLAGS="-O3 -ip -ftz"
export FC="ifort"
export FCFLAGS="-O3 -ip -ftz"
# without MPI
./configure --prefix=/opt/cesga/octopus-3.0.1 --disable-python --disable-gdlib --with-blas="-L/opt/cesga/intel/intel11.0/Compiler/11.0/069/mkl/lib/64 -lmkl -lguide -lpthread" --with-lapack="-L/opt/cesga/intel/intel11.0/Compiler/11.0/069/mkl/lib/64 -lmkl_lapack -lguide -lpthread" --with-fft=fftw3 --with-netcdf=netcdf --with-sparskit="-L/opt/cesga/SPARSKIT-2/lib -lskit"
then I checked the installation and everything was correct:
Passed: 25 / 25
Skipped: 0 / 25
Everything seems to be OK
Total run-time of the testsuite: 00:07:55
Now, I have to install octopus 3.1.0. I follow the same steps but with this version I have between (8-10) failed tests.
I have tried to go down the optimization flags (and update the compiler) but several segmentation faults always appear when I run the tests.
For example, with this script (very aggressive approach):
$ cat script_de_configuracion.sh
#!/bin/bash
module load gsl/1.12 icc/11.0.083 ifort/11.0.083 fftw/3.2 mkl/10.1.2 impi/3.2.1.009 netcdf/4.0 sparskit/2
export CC="icc"
export CFLAGS="-O3 -ip -ftz"
export LDFLAGS="-lguide -lpthread -lm"
export F77="ifort"
export FFLAGS="-O3 -ip -ftz"
export FC="ifort"
export FCFLAGS="-03 -ip -ftz"
# without MPI
./configure --prefix=/sfs/home/cesga/mpan/octopus-3.1.0 --disable-gdlib --with-blas="-L/opt/cesga/intel/intel11.0/Compiler/11.0/083/mkl/10.1.2.024/lib/64 -lmkl -lguide -lpthread" --with-lapack="-L/opt/cesga/intel/intel11.0/Compiler/11.0/083/mkl/10.1.2.024/lib/64 -lmkl_lapack -lguide -lpthread" --with-fft=fftw3 --with-netcdf=netcdf --with-sparskit="-L/opt/cesga/SPARSKIT-2/lib -lskit" > script_de_configuracion.sh.log
I have this errors:
Passed: 24 / 34
Skipped: 1 / 34
Failed: 9 / 34
testfile # failed testcases
--------------------------------------------------------------------
finite_systems_2d/02-fock-darwin.test 10
finite_systems_3d/07-spin_orbit_coupling.test 34
finite_systems_3d/09-spinors.test 8
finite_systems_3d/20-eigensolver.test 4
periodic_systems/01-free_electrons.test 11
periodic_systems/02-cosine_potential.test 12
periodic_systems/03-sodium_chain.test 24
periodic_systems/04-silicon.test 28
periodic_systems/05-lithium.test 28
Total run-time of the testsuite: 00:07:35
A segmentation fault example:
Using workdir : /tmp/octopus.WuOrPC
Using executable : /sfs/home/cesga/mpan/octopus-3.1.0/src/testsuite/../src/main/octopus
Using test file : ./finite_systems_2d/02-fock-darwin.test
Using input file : ./finite_systems_2d/02-fock-darwin.01-ground_state.inp
Starting test run ...
Executing: cd /tmp/octopus.WuOrPC; /sfs/home/cesga/mpan/octopus-3.1.0/src/testsuite/../src/main/octopus > out
forrtl: severe (174): SIGSEGV, segmentation fault occurred
Image PC Routine Line Source
libmkl_i2p.so 20000000048DC010 Unknown Unknown Unknown
libmkl_i2p.so 20000000048998D0 Unknown Unknown Unknown
libmkl_lapack.so 20000000002B36E0 Unknown Unknown Unknown
libmkl_i2p.so 2000000004899BF0 Unknown Unknown Unknown
libmkl_lapack.so 20000000002B50E0 Unknown Unknown Unknown
libmkl_intel_lp64 20000000018F76C0 Unknown Unknown Unknown
octopus 400000000054FC00 Unknown Unknown Unknown
octopus 400000000054EF80 Unknown Unknown Unknown
octopus 4000000000549780 Unknown Unknown Unknown
octopus 4000000000295FC0 Unknown Unknown Unknown
octopus 400000000004E010 Unknown Unknown Unknown
octopus 400000000004F700 Unknown Unknown Unknown
octopus 400000000000A410 Unknown Unknown Unknown
libc.so.6.1 2000000003EF3C20 Unknown Unknown Unknown
octopus 400000000000A240 Unknown Unknown Unknown
Finished test run.
Any idea to fix them???
--
Atentamente,
Miguel Pan Fidalgo (Applications Technician)
mail: mpan at cesga.es
Avda. de Vigo s/n 15705, Santiago de Compostela
Telf.: +34 981 569810 Fax: 981 594616
-------------------------------------------------------------------------
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://www.tddft.org/pipermail/octopus-users/attachments/20090806/957304d3/attachment.html
More information about the Octopus-users
mailing list